Faye D. McCollough of Samson passed away on Tuesday, April 11, 2023. She was 94. Funeral services will be held at 2:00 p.m. on Thursday, April 13, 2023, at Weeks Assembly of God Church with Rev. Vernon Ray Davis, Mark Davis, and Rev. Lisa Jenkins, officiating. Burial will follow in the church cemetery with Pittman Funeral Home of Samson, directing. The family will receive friends prior to the service on Thursday, beginning at 1:00 p.m.
Mrs. McCollough was born in Coffee County, AL on October 17, 1928, to the late Rube and Irene Currenton Davis. She was a graduate of Kinston High School, Class of 1946. She was preceded in death by her husband, James Ollen McCollough; and a brother, Rex Davis.
She is survived by five children, Dianne Reid (Ronny), Brenda McCollough, both of Samson, Michael McCollough (Carolyn) of Coffee Springs, Scott McCollough (Catrina) of Ocean Springs, MS, and Susan Albercrombie (Jason) of Skipperville; eleven grandchildren; twenty-two great grandchildren; twelve great-great grandchildren; brother, Vernon Ray Davis of Tuscaloosa; sister, Evelyn Hollon (Ernest) of Montgomery; and numerous nieces and nephews.
